Glimpse - as a noun

A quick look

A brief or incomplete view

Example: "From the window he could catch a glimpse of the lake"

A vague indication

Example: "He caught only a glimpse of the professor's meaning"

Glimpse - as a verb

Catch a glimpse of or see briefly

Example: "We glimpsed the queen as she got into her limousine"
